# Nightly backfill scheduler (Tarnow)

Tarnow kicks off backfills at 02:10 local Bresley time. Releases must never ship between 01:45 and 04:00; the scheduler locks partition tables during that window. If a release is urgent, pause Tarnow via the admin flag and note it in the Hollis log. Failed backfills retry twice, then page the on-call. Before cutting any release, confirm Tarnow's last run succeeded by querying the run ledger directly. Connect to the ledger database using the string below.

primary connection of yagep-kahip = redis://giliel_svc:zYiKsLL2PLpfPL@db-348f.xolmarsys.corp:5432/fenwyn

## Read-Replica Lag Alarm

New folks: the ReplicaLagHigh alarm covers the Ostrel reporting replicas. It fires when lag exceeds 90 seconds for five minutes. Most triggers come from the nightly Bramwell export job, which is expected and auto-resolves. Do not fail over the replica yourself — that requires the data-platform lead's approval and a change ticket. If the alarm persists past 20 minutes with no export running, write to the platform inbox.

billing contact of yahip-yadup = eliax.druix@zemvarworks.corp

Night shift: evacuation-chair store on Stairwell C, Level 3, was restocked today. Two Havermont chairs serviced, one sent to Drayle Safety for repair. Check the seal on the store door at 02:00 rounds. If the seal is broken, log it and re-secure. Door access for the store uses the pass below.

staff pass of fajop-kajop = bdg-H-83